Having worked with some of my colleagues on border transportation issues down in Imperial County, this is one (pipe...?) dream "on the list" of some of those folks... There are arguments that this might make more sense, as the demographics and destination sets have changed. It would be costly... If, the much more viable rail passenger services from the Coachella Valley to the IE and LAUS ever become "real", then it might be worth a closer look at the costs and benefits of such an extension to the Imperial County/Mexicali "metro" areas....

PHX would take at least 8 hours from LA, under former SP/Amtrak schedules.

My first priority to looking at real passenger rail system transportation "needs", on corridors with substantial demonstrated travel demand (auto and existing rail), and with traffic congestion/capacity relief. So the Imperial Valley, and heresy of heresies even PHX, is probably not at the top of my "policiy" or "project" lists...

I have criticized these kind of train fan "fantasy" maps and "promises", like the one the Secretary of Transportation felt compelled to tweet out, because this kind of nonsense ignorantly panders to unrealistic expectations. I just saw another equally ludicrous "high speed" map on a paid Facebook ad, pandering to the ignorant, with things like high speed rail lines to South Texas.....

We need to prioritize well planned rail passenger projects, with good public benefits, that can be delivered in a timely manner, at realistic and predictable costs, which the public can actually use for real travel "needs". A program that does that, which prioritizes based on those factors, will naturally tend to fund "needed" rail passenger projects like the Del Mar bluffs bypass, LAUS run through, the ACE connection via Altamont to the Valley (so taxpayers can see viable services which can connect to the "runaway money trains" stranded investment from Chowchilla to Wasco), over some of the embrrassing fiasco's like we have experienced with the CAHSRA.
